/* output_header.c: a plugin prints out the client request header
* fields to stdout
* A sample internal plugin to use the HdrPrint functions and the TSIOBuffers
* that the functions utilize.
*
* The plugin simply prints all the incoming request headers
*
* Note: tested on Solaris only.
*/
#include <stdio.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include "ts/ts.h"
#include "tscore/ink_defs.h"
#define PLUGIN_NAME "output_header"
static void
handle_dns(TSHttpTxn txnp, TSCont contp ATS_UNUSED)
{
TSMBuffer bufp;
TSMLoc hdr_loc;
TSIOBuffer output_buffer;
TSIOBufferReader reader;
int total_avail;
TSIOBufferBlock block;
const char *block_start;
int64_t block_avail;
char *output_string;
int64_t output_len;
if (TSHttpTxnClientReqGet(txnp, &bufp, &hdr_loc) != TS_SUCCESS) {
TSDebug(PLUGIN_NAME, "couldn't retrieve client request header");
TSError("[%s] Couldn't retrieve client request header", PLUGIN_NAME);
goto done;
}
output_buffer = TSIOBufferCreate();
reader = TSIOBufferReaderAlloc(output_buffer);
/* This will print just MIMEFields and not
the http request line */
TSDebug(PLUGIN_NAME, "Printing the hdrs ... ");
TSMimeHdrPrint(bufp, hdr_loc, output_buffer);
if (TSHandleMLocRelease(bufp, TS_NULL_MLOC, hdr_loc) == TS_ERROR) {
TSDebug(PLUGIN_NAME, "non-fatal: error releasing MLoc");
TSError("[%s] non-fatal: Couldn't release MLoc", PLUGIN_NAME);
}
/* Find out how the big the complete header is by
seeing the total bytes in the buffer. We need to
look at the buffer rather than the first block to
see the size of the entire header */
total_avail = TSIOBufferReaderAvail(reader);
/* Allocate the string with an extra byte for the string
terminator */
output_string = (char *)TSmalloc(total_avail + 1);
output_len = 0;
/* We need to loop over all the buffer blocks to make
sure we get the complete header since the header can
be in multiple blocks */
block = TSIOBufferReaderStart(reader);
while (block) {
block_start = TSIOBufferBlockReadStart(block, reader, &block_avail);
/* We'll get a block pointer back even if there is no data
left to read so check for this condition and break out of
the loop. A block with no data to read means we've exhausted
buffer of data since if there was more data on a later
block in the chain, this block would have been skipped over */
if (block_avail == 0) {
break;
}
memcpy(output_string + output_len, block_start, block_avail);
output_len += block_avail;
/* Consume the data so that we get to the next block */
TSIOBufferReaderConsume(reader, block_avail);
/* Get the next block now that we've consumed the
data off the last block */
block = TSIOBufferReaderStart(reader);
}
/* Terminate the string */
output_string[output_len] = '\0';
output_len++;
/* Free up the TSIOBuffer that we used to print out the header */
TSIOBufferReaderFree(reader);
TSIOBufferDestroy(output_buffer);
/* Although I'd never do this a production plugin, printf
the header so that we can see it's all there */
TSDebug(PLUGIN_NAME, "%s", output_string);
TSfree(output_string);
done:
TSHttpTxnReenable(txnp, TS_EVENT_HTTP_CONTINUE);
}
static int
hdr_plugin(TSCont contp, TSEvent event, void *edata)
{
TSHttpTxn txnp = (TSHttpTxn)edata;
switch (event) {
case TS_EVENT_HTTP_OS_DNS:
handle_dns(txnp, contp);
return 0;
default:
break;
}
return 0;
}
void
TSPluginInit(int argc ATS_UNUSED, const char *argv[] ATS_UNUSED)
{
TSPluginRegistrationInfo info;
info.plugin_name = PLUGIN_NAME;
info.vendor_name = "Apache Software Foundation";
info.support_email = "dev@trafficserver.apache.org";
if (TSPluginRegister(&info) != TS_SUCCESS) {
TSError("[%s] Plugin registration failed", PLUGIN_NAME);
goto error;
}
TSHttpHookAdd(TS_HTTP_OS_DNS_HOOK, TSContCreate(hdr_plugin, NULL));
error:
TSError("[%s] Plugin not initialized", PLUGIN_NAME);
}
